    Aegean Airlines A36301/AEE6301 positioning from Shannon to Athens after maintenance, seems to have had a cabin pressurisation issue. The aircraft initiated a rapid descent from just above FL200 to FL100 and has turned around heading back to Shannon. The aircraft is an A321-232 registration SX-DGP, it had been at Shannon since mid March.
